#314d58 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#314d58 is composed of 19.2% red, 30.2% green and 34.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 44.3% cyan, 12.5% magenta, 0% yellow and 65.5% black. It has a hue angle of 196.9 degrees, a saturation of 28.5% and a lightness of 26.9%. #314d58 color hex could be obtained by blending #629ab0 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#336666.

Shades and Tints of #314d58
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#070b0c is the darkest color, while #ffffff is the lightest one.

Tones of #314d58
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#414648 is the less saturated color, while #026287 is the most saturated one.
